Jose Montaner, a barbecue restaurant-owner on Mallorca in the 1960s, devised the concept of pairing dinner and jousting to lure customers on the heavily touristed Spanish island, then teamed up with other investors to open the first North American Medieval Times in Kissimmee, Florida, in 1983. 311 reviews of Medieval Times Dinner & Tournament 'Everything was amazing We got to view it early since my husband had worked on the building. Dinner theater devolved into theme restaurants in the 1980s, sprouting like weeds 12 Planet Hollywoods here, a dozen Hard Rock Cafes there and often disappearing just as quickly.
